Why do UAE villa owners choose an external home lift?

In many UAE villas, indoor space is tight and renovations can get messy fast. An external lift is often chosen when:

  • the stairwell is too narrow for a comfortable internal solution
  • the homeowner wants to keep interiors untouched
  • there’s a side setback, courtyard, or rear space that gives a clean vertical run

The goal is simple: add access between floors without turning the villa into a long construction site.

What is an “outdoor lift concept” and why should you care?

An outdoor lift concept is built and specified for outdoor installation from day one. In practice, that usually means:

  • prefabricated modules
  • a ready-made shaft, commonly offered in steel or glass
  • defined outdoor equipment and sealing details

This approach matters because outdoor reliability is mostly about protection: water, dust, UV exposure, and corrosion.

What outdoor equipment should an external home lift include in the UAE?

When you compare quotes, this is the checklist that separates a true outdoor-ready solution from a risky one.

What should be standard for weather protection?

A strong reference list for outdoor equipment includes:

  • anti-corrosive treatment of the bottom frame and platform
  • flood-protected electrical compartment
  • aluminium doors (rust-resistant)
  • sealed, weather-resistant call buttons (an example rating used in the market is IP55)
  • outdoor roof plus door canopies (plexiglass or steel options are common)
  • sealed glazed shaft panels and sealed glass panels with rubber seals to reduce water infiltration and condensation

What should UAE homeowners take from this list?

If one of these items is missing, you’re more likely to see:

  • dust getting into sensitive areas
  • water risk during heavy rain events
  • corrosion showing early in coastal locations
  • higher service needs because weather protection was treated as an “extra”

Should you choose a glass shaft or a solid exterior shaft for a UAE villa?

Both can work. The better choice depends on sun exposure, privacy, and cleaning tolerance.

A practical rule: if the lift sits in full-day sun or faces neighbors closely, solid shafts often make life easier. If it’s in a shaded courtyard or protected elevation, glass can look great.

What technical specifications should you check before planning an outdoor lift?

Specs help you quickly confirm whether a lift can serve your villa layout and whether the building work will stay reasonable.

Here are real examples of outdoor platform lift specifications used in the market:

Specification Value Why It Matters for UAE Villas
Drive system Screw and nut Reliable in dusty conditions
Speed Max 0.15 m/s Compliant, smooth operation
Max travel 15 m Serves G+2 + roof access
Max stops 6 Handles multi-story villas
Lift pit 0/50 mm options Reduces civil works and waterproofing complexity
Rated load 400/500 kg Accommodates wheelchair, groceries, multiple users
Machine room Integrated (MRL) No rooftop structure needed
Standards MD 2006/42/EC, EN 81-41 European safety compliance

Why do these numbers matter in a UAE villa?

  • Stops and travel decide if you can serve G+1, G+2, or roof access cleanly.
  • 0/50 mm pit options affect how much you need to break flooring and how you waterproof the base.
  • Integrated machine room helps when you don’t want extra rooftop structures.
  • Rated load affects comfort and real usage (wheelchair, stroller, groceries).
  • High safety standard compliance are reliable and provide peace of mind

How do you plan an outdoor home lift for UAE heat and direct sun?

This is where many outdoor projects succeed or fail.

Some outdoor lift concepts state they are designed to function at approximately -10°C to +40°C, and mention additional options and temperature-control solutions for more extreme climates.

For the UAE, treat that as a planning signal:

  • Choose the best elevation, not just the easiest one
  • Avoid west-facing glass without shading
  • Plan ventilation paths in the shaft
  • Use canopies and roofs as functional protection, not decoration
  • Ask what temperature-control options exist if your site gets intense afternoon sun

What installation steps should you expect for an external home lift in a villa?

A good provider will treat this like a building integration project, not a product drop.

What should be checked during the site survey?

  • landing positions and door clearances on every level
  • sun path and exposure on the chosen elevation
  • drainage route and base detailing
  • structural fixing points and wall condition
  • service access for maintenance
  • privacy lines from street and neighbors

How long does installation usually take once the site is ready?

Some ready-made outdoor lift concepts are designed for installation in 5–10 days because they arrive as prefabricated modules.
In the UAE, total project time still depends on approvals, civil works, electrical readiness, and façade finishing.

What maintenance helps an outdoor home lift stay reliable in the UAE?

Outdoor lifts need a simple routine. Dust and heat are constant here.

What should homeowners do regularly?

  • wipe dust from door sills and visible seals
  • keep the base area free of sand build-up
  • check that drainage points are not blocked after rain
  • watch for cracked sealant or loose trims

What should professional servicing focus on?

  • weather seals, canopies, and enclosure sealing points
  • door alignment and smooth travel
  • electrical compartment protection (especially flood protection)
  • corrosion checks for exposed elements

What are the most common mistakes with outdoor villa lift projects in the UAE?

  • Choosing glass without a heat and glare plan
  • Missing basic outdoor equipment such as roof, door canopies, and sealed call buttons
  • No drainage planning at the base
  • Poor service access planning
  • Ignoring coastal corrosion risk

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) on Outdoor Home Lift

Q: Can I install an external home lift in Dubai, Abu Dhabi, or Sharjah without changing my interior layout?

A: Often yes, if your villa has a suitable vertical run outside. The site survey should confirm landings, setbacks, and fixing points.

Q: What outdoor equipment should I insist on in the UAE?

A: At minimum: anti-corrosion protection, flood-protected electrics, aluminium doors, sealed weather-resistant call buttons, plus roof and door canopies.

Q: Is a glass outdoor shaft a bad idea in the UAE?

A: Not necessarily. It can work well in shaded areas, but it needs smart sun planning and a realistic cleaning routine.

Q: Do outdoor lifts need a deep pit?

A: Not always. Some outdoor lift configurations list pit options like 0/50 mm, which can reduce heavy civil work.

Q: How many floors can an outdoor home lift serve?

A: Examples on the market include up to 6 stops and up to 15 m travel, depending on the system.

Q: How long does an outdoor lift installation take?

A: Some modular outdoor lift concepts are designed for 5–10 days installation after the site is prepared. Civil works and approvals can extend the overall timeline.

Q: What should I ask about heat performance in the UAE?

A: Ask what temperature range the lift is designed for and what temperature-control options exist for harsher conditions.
